Swiftsure was first of eight or more similar locomotives with a single pair of driving wheels built by George Forrester and Company (Forresters) from 1834. The tank variant was the first passenger tank engine to enter service in the world. Locomotives were supplied to the Liverpool and Manchester Railway (L&MR), Dublin and Kingstown (D&KR), London and Greenwich (L&GR), Birmingham and Gloucester (B&GR), and a few other minor railways.
